Specifications
Current - Output (Max): 3.33A
Size / Dimension: 4.60" L x 1.86" W x 1.05" H (116.8mm x 47.2mm x 26.7mm)
Package / Case: Full Brick
Mounting Type: Through Hole
Efficiency: 88%
Operating Temperature: -10°C ~ 85°C
Features: OCP, OTP, OVP, SCP
Applications: ITE (Commercial)
Voltage - Isolation: 3kV
Power (Watts): 50W
Series: VE-200™
Voltage - Output 3: --
Voltage - Output 2: --
Voltage - Output 1: 15V
Voltage - Input (Max): 20V
Voltage - Input (Min): 10V
Number of Outputs: 1
Type: Isolated Module
Part Status: Active
Packaging: Bulk

DC–DC converters are electronic devices that are used to step up or step down direct current (DC) voltage levels according to a range of applications. In this way, DC–DC converters can be used to produce the different voltages and current levels that are needed for various components in a variety of electrical systems. Since different systems require different voltages and currents, DC–DC converters are versatile and important components of many electrical devices and systems.The VE-B02-EY-F4 is one of the latest DC–DC converters designed to meet the needs of both industrial and consumer applications.
